Default Zyxel Zyxel P-2602H-D1A phone book limitations

The speed dial function of the P-2602H-D1A phone book has only 10 digits
and
does not seem to support pause characters in the telephone numbers.
For maintenance the modem can be accessed via a web- as well as a
telnet- and ftp interface.
For the latter two I cannot find more detailed info at Zyxel
(http:// www.zyxel.com en ftp://ftp.zyxel.com) or elsewhere on the web
or usenet.
If somebody knows of more resources then please respond.
